CentOS7 64位系统安装jdk
查看系统是否安装了自带的openJDK,先查看CentOS相关的安装信息:
$rpm -qa | grep java
可以用java -version命令查看系统自带jdk的版本信息
$ java -version
卸载系统自带openJDK (如果没有安装,则跳过此步)
$ rpm -e --nodeps java-1.7.0-openjdk-1.7.0.19-2.3.9.1.el6_4.x86_64
$ rpm -e --nodeps java-1.6.0-openjdk-1.6.0.0-1.61.1.11.11.el6_4.x86_64
$ rpm -e --nodeps tzdata-java-2013b-1.el6.noarch
安装自己的JDK:
JDK下载地址:
http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html
下载后上传到linux服务器中
$ rpm -ivh jdk-8u112-linux-x64.rpm
配置环境变量
$vim /etc/profile
在profile文件末尾加入如下内容:
JAVA_HOME=/usr/java/jdk1.8.0_112
JRE_HOME=/usr/java/jdk1.8.0_112/jre
P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in
C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/lib
export JAVA_HOME JRE_HOME PATH CLASSPATH
使配置文件立即生效
$ source /etc/profile
验证是否安装成功
依次输入java, java -version, javac可以查看到jdk的安装信息,说明安装成功
查看JAVA_HOME
$ echo $JAVA_HOME
/usr/java/jdk1.8.0_112
附:
windows环境下安装JDK之后环境变量是这样配置的:
JAVA_HOME:当前jdk路径
PATH:%JAVA_HOME%/bin;%JAVA_HOME%/jre/bin
CLASSPATH:.;%JAVA_HOME%/lib/dt.jar;%JAVA_HOME%/lib/tools.jar
关键字:java, JDK, lib
本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场,不承担相关法律责任。如若转载,请注明出处。 如若内容造成侵权/违法违规/事实不符,请点击【内容举报】进行投诉反馈!